Disposal/Disposition
From 'Vocabulary' part of The ABC Of Plain Words by Sir E Gowers (1951)

For some purposes these words are interchangeable; for others they are so different that there is no danger of confusion. "When doubt arises", says Fowler, "it is worth while to remember that disposition corresponds to dispose, and disposal to dispose of". Thus disposition is the word for orderly arrangement and disposal the word for getting rid of.
